  • Low-key gatherings: Summer is a great time to reconnect with friends, and lighting up the fire pit is reason enough to have them over. It instantly creates a low-key hangout for anyone you want to invite. It creates a focal point for any outdoor gathering, day or night.
  • Create sparks: A fire pit is an excellent excuse for romance. Maybe you have gotten into the habit of watching TV in the evenings with your significant other after being cooped up inside for the winter. Now’s the time to reignite the conversation and the sparks between you by sitting side by side outside and watching the flames.
  • You have options: Fire pits can rely on wood, natural gas or propane for energy, whichever fits your home best. There are pros and cons to each options. Learn about all the choices from a fireplace contractor in Seattle, WA.
  • Flexible price points: Fire pits are available at numerous price points—from low-budget wood-burning pits, to fancy natural gas-powered fire art, there’s a fire pit that will fit your style and budget.
  • Make dinner an event: Dinner can be an event with a fire pit. Instead of scrambling in the kitchen to get dinner on the table, the whole family can spend the evening outside over the fire. Use a grill rack, or wrap up foil packets to tuck into the coals.
  • Set the mood: If you’re planning an outdoor party or just looking for an additional source of backyard lighting, there’s no better outdoor lighting than a fire pit. The warm light creates a great lively, low-key mood for any outdoor gathering.
  • Flexible in spaces: Whether you have a large or small space to work with, there are fire pit options for you. The right custom fireplace contractor in Seattle, WA can accommodate the space you have available.
  • Use it year-round: Once you have a fire pit, you’ll find excuses to light it up all year round! While it’s wonderful in the summer for outdoor lighting and s’mores, nothing can beat curling up with hot cocoa by the fire pit once the weather starts cooling off.
  • Increase the value of your home: A bonus of a fire pit is that it will increase the value of your home! An attractive, well-maintained fire pit can raise the value of your home and make it more appealing to buyers.
